Mengatasi Delay, Lion Air Akan Mengganti Sistem Rotasi Dan Schedule Penerbangannya

Lion Air berencana mengganti sistem rotasi dan schedule penerbangan perusahaan. Pasalnya, sistem yang dipakai saat ini sudah tidak mampu meng-cover jumlah frekuensi penerbangan Lion Air. Sehingga ini menjadi salah satu penyebab seringnya maskapai ini mengalami delay yang merugikan para penumpang.

Daniel Putut Kuncoro, Managing Directur Lion Air Group mengatakan, delay penerbangan disebabkan dua faktor yakni internal seperti kesiapan pesawat Selain itu kondisi kru serta faktor eksternal seperti cuaca,  traffic dan lain-lain.

Lion Air berkomitnen untuk melakukan perbaikan di internal agar permasalahan delay bisa di atasi. Menurut Daniel, penyebab sejumlah delay yang menimpa maskapi Lion Air baru-baru ini diakibatkan oleh sistem rotasi dan schedule yang mereka pakai sudah tidak memadai lagi dengan kondisi frekuensi.

"Sekarang Lion Air sudah melayani 600 rute. Waktu kami beli sistem yang kita pakai saat ini, frekuensi masih di bawah 400 rute. Vendor yang kita pakai memang sudah menawarkan optimalisasi tapi tetap saja belum bisa memadai," jelas Daniel.

Oleh karena itu, perusahaan ini memutuskan mengganti aero sistem dengan yang baru yang bisa mengatur rotasi kru dan pesawat. Daniel menargetkan pergantian sistem ini bisa dilakukan dalam dua bulan ke depan.


Selain itu, lanjut Daniel, pihaknya akan menaikkan set crew pesawat lebih tinggi dari ketentuan minimum dari kementerian Perhubungan 1:3:5 untuk mencegah terjadinya delay. Dengan jumlah pesawat mereka yang terus meningkat, Lion Air akan menaikkan set crew menjadi 1:5 atau setiap satu pesawat memiliki 10 kru.

Kemudian, maskapai ini juga akan melakukan tambahan pesawat standby di beberapa kota yang diindetifikasi mengalami masalah beberapa bulan terakhir. "Kami sudah tempatkan beberapa pesawat standby di beberapa kota sesuai SOP yang kita daftarakan. Kami buat tambahan di beberapa kota. kami juga siapkan pesawat badan lebar untuk meng-cover bandara yang bisa didarati pesawat wide body," tambah Daniel.

Sementara terkait bocornya avtur di pesawat Lion Boeing 737 900 di Bandara Juanda, Daniel mengatakan pihaknya akan segera melakukan investigasi internal.

"Kami langsung investigasi terkait kemarin terjadi ovefill fuel. Enginering kami akan periksa semua pesawat boeing 737 yang kita punya karena ini yang pertama kami alami." ungkap Daniel. Saat ini Lion Air tercatat memiliki pesawat Boeing 737 NG sebanyak 108 pesawat. Tiga merupakan pesawat 330 airbus wide body dan 2 pesawat 737 400.

Mulai 31 Maret 2017 Lion Air Grup Membuka Rute Denpasar - Brisbane, Queensland, Australia

Lion Air Grup membuka rute Denpasar-Brisbane, Queensland, Australia mulai 31 Maret 2017 melalui perusahaan patungan Malindo Airways dengan menggunakan pesawat Boeing 780-400 Malindo Air.

Penerbangan sekitar 4.492 km dengan waktu tempuh rata-rata dari Denpasar (Bali) ke Brisbane 5 jam 25 menit tersebut akan dilayani setiap hari pada pukul 22.00 WIT dari Denpasar dan pukul 07.00 pagi dari Brisbane.

Penerbangan dengan ongkos Jakarta - Brisbane sekitar Rp2,9 juta per orang, selain membidik wisatawan asing dari Brisbane ke Denpasar juga menyasar penumpang dari Kula Lumpur menuju Brisbane via Denpasar.

Manajer PR Lion Andy Saladin mengakui pasar ini cukup potensial [secara ekonomi]. Ada 22 penerbangan seminggu dari Denpasar (Bali) ke Brisbane.

"Penerbangan ini menggunakan Boeing 780-400 dengan 12 seats bisnis'," ujar Andy.

Malindo Airways [Malindo Air] adalah maskapai penerbangan bertarif rendah yang berbasis di Malaysia. Maskapai ini merupakan perusahaan patungan antara Malaysia National Aerospace and Defence Industries (NADI) (51%) dan Lion Air dari Indonesia (49%).

Nama Malindo berasal dari nama negara masing-masing: Malaysia dan Indonesia. Awalnya Malindo Air direncanakan beroperasi pada 1 Mei 2013 dari terminal baru KLIA2. Akan tetapi, pihak Malindo Air memajukan tanggal peluncurannya menjadi pertengahan Maret 2013 dengan rute domestik. Malindo Air hanya menyediakan kursi kelas ekonomi dan bisnis.

Malindo memiliki total pesawat 45 yakni 16 Unit ATR 72-600, 23 Unit Boeing 737-800 dan enam unit Boeing 737-900.

Brisbane adalah ibu kita negara bagian Queensland , Australia. Berdasar data per Juni 2004, Brisbane berpenduduk sekitar 957.010 jiwa di pusat kota dan 1,77 juta jiwa di wilayah metropolitan.

Lion Air Group Launches Batik Air

Lion Air and Batik Air

Lion Air Group will again hit the Indonesian aviation world with the launch of the latest airline subsidiary Batik Air to serve full service but at a cheaper price than are currently they have.

"Today we launched the latest airline, a subsidiary of Lion Air, the Batik Air, which will serve full services with competitive prices and excellent service," said Lion Air general director Edward Sirait while welcoming the arrival of the first Batik Air aircraft in Terminal 3 Soekarno-Hatta Airport, Cengkareng, Tangerang, on Thursday (25/4).

He adds to this new airline, it will put forward the concept of service excellence and timeliness. Regarding tariffs, of course, will be adjusted and will be more competitive than it already is today.

"We note the condition of the market, that go into the business, if the market vulnerable to price, we will consider. Full service different from the LCC (low cost carrier), frequent flyer passengers, the price is not the main, essential services and the timeliness of the service, "he said.

According to Edward Sirait, the presence of Batik Air not be a contender for full service airline that already exist today that Garuda Indonesia, but to be given the complement of air passenger growth of 20% per year

LION AIR passenger numbers in the first quarter rose 10%
lion_air_passenger_number_indonesia_national_airline

Indonesia national airline PT Lion Mentari Airlines or Lion Air successful a growing number of passengers during the first quarter of this year. The number of airline passengers increased by 10% over the same quarter last year.

General Director of Lion Air, Edward Sirait explain the increase in passenger numbers due to the revitalization of the fleet is carried out by the company. In addition, Lion Air also made additional flight frequencies on domestic routes.

In the first quarter of this year, Lion Air recorded an increase of about 800,000 passengers, up 10% over the same quarter last year amounted to 7.2 million passengers.

"Of the eight million passengers, mostly from domestic flights is 98% or 7,840,000 passengers, while the rest coming from international flight around 160,000 passengers," said Edward. 

Edward said that most domestic routes is Jakarta-Medan route. This route has 20 times flights per day. The load factor for the Jakarta-Medan route stable at 82.5%. While on international routes, the airline is still concentrating on the route from Jakarta to Singapore, Jakarta to Jeddah and Jakarta to Kuala Lumpur.

Although there is the addition of 10% the number of passengers in the first quarter of 2012, but he was pessimistic until the end of this year could raise the overall airline passenger numbers up 10%. Edward argued, the month of July, after the September school holidays and after the Eid holidays are the low season.

Last year, Lion Air transport 24.97 million domestic passengers in 2011, or approximately 41.59% of total domestic passengers nationwide. Edward says, the flight routes which opened earlier this year was a direct route from Jakarta to Manado since last February 2012. While the end of this month Lion Air will open two direct routes namely Surabaya to Ambon and Surabaya to Palu without transit in Balikpapan.

Lion Air plans to go public delayed
go_public_lion_air_delay

Lion Air to delay plans to go public this year worth more than U.S. $ 1 billion. Rusdi Kirana, chief executive officer (CEO), Lion Air said, the delay made due to the deteriorating condition of the stock market.

As info before, Lion Air has ambitious expansion plans to increase its flight business. Moreover, the Indonesia's airline company already has had a record of buying 200 Boeing aircraft.

"We can not do it (go public) this year because of the situation with the financial crisis is not so good," said CEO Rusdi Kirana. Rusdi said Lion Air currently has a market share of 51% of domestic flights and plans to go public when their market share reached 60%, something which was expected to occur two years into the future.

Rusdi Kirana ever mentioned, he does not need the IPO funds to pay for orders the plane. Some time ago, the airline is the world's attention, because the largest aircraft order valued at U.S. $ 21.7 billion.

Airbus blamed the United States (U.S.) to apply political pressure to secure an agreement to buy the aircraft. More details, Lion Air to buy 230 planes of shorter route, which purchase was signed in the presence of President Barack Obama.

Regarding the case of drug use by Lion Air, Rudi denied. "The rumors say, the pilots I worked too hard, so they use drink and drugs," said Rusdi. He also explained, "People make up stories to discredit us," he said. In addition to developing its business, Rusdi claims to have set up 1,000 homes for his airline's staff.

Rusdi Kirasna also criticized Europe that still apply black list to Lion Air. While Garuda Indonesia and five other airlines to get relief. "I do not care if the EU wants to blacklist Lion Air, Indonesia is a our market, and I want justice," said Rusdi.

LION AIR to buy 230 Boeing aircraft worth US$ 21.7 billion
lion_air_buy_purchased_230_aircraft_boeing

Lion Air has signed a purchase of 230 new types of aircraft made ​​by Boeing Co.. Purchase of 737 aircraft jetliner amounted to U.S. $ 21.7 billion is the biggest deal for Boeing.

Purchase agreement will be signed on Friday (18 / 1). U.S. President Barack Obama is following the ASEAN Summit to witness the signing of the sale and purchase contract.

In this sale, Lion Air will buy 201 737 MAX aircraft with engine has been upgraded. In addition, the Indonesia national airline will also buy 29 737-900s air craft types.

Lion Air President Director Rusdi Kirana said the new aircraft that have advanced technology and highly efficient Lion Air will help develop low-cost carrier. "The addition of these aircraft will also add new routes," he said, Friday (18/11).

RBC Capital Markets analyst Rob Stallard said, the purchase of plane by Lion Air made as an big deal for Boeing. "It means a lot to improve security to Boeing and MAX," he said.

LION Air and SRIWIJAYA Air will work on FULL SERVICE carrier

lion_air_low_cost_carrier

Lion Air plans to upgrade the flight service from low cost carrier into a full-service airlines. For this full service, Lion Air to establish a new subsidiary, PT Space Aviation Service.

General Director of Lion Air, Edward Sirait claimed to have been taking care of the completeness of the business license for this Air Space. "The filing is already running, we are currently completing the documents in accordance with government regulations," said Edward.

Lion Air sees the potential flight for full services is very large. Edward saw its market continues to grow. Because of that, he hopes this Air Space could soon be operational next year. "We are targeting November 2012," he said.

To work on the full market these services, Lion Air will allocate around 10-12 aircraft. Already, it is reviewing the routes to be served. "So the market to be clear," he said.

sriwijaya_air_full_service_carrier Sriwijaya Air is also will follow to upgrade their flight service. Vice President Director of Sriwijaya Air Hasudungan Pandiangan claimed to have been collecting documents to transform into full flight carrier. "We are filling but do not propose the SIUP becuase not opening a new company. The name of the airline still remain the same, Sriwijaya Air," explains Hasudungan.

He also admitted it is reviewing the routes to be served. "We are targeting this transformation is completed in mid 2012," he said. So far Sriwijaya Air applying service to its passengers with the concept of medium service. The concept of rule-based medium may only provide a maximum tariff of 90% of the rate above the specified limit. The airline allowed to provide service snacks and beverages.

According to Bambang S Ervan, Head of Communications and Information Ministry of Transportation when the airline moved from medium service to full services without creating a new subsidiary then simply report to the Directorate General of Civil Aviation only. "Then after that the process is published to the public. While to open up a new subsidiary must submit SIUP first, "said Bambang.

The Director General of Civil Aviation Herry Bakti admitted that Lion Air’s SIUP is in the process. As for reports of Sriwijaya Air had not yet received their request for a report to the next grade to full service.

LION Air passengers increased during the Islamic holiday
lion_air_passengers_islamic_holiday

PT Lion Mentari Airlines recorded an increase in the number of passengers during the  Islamic holiday this year, which is reach 1.2 million passengers, increase 20%compared with the last transportation year's period.

Edward Sirait, Managing Director of Lion Air, the frequency of flights during Islamic holiday transport until today reached 157 scheduled flights, an increase of 40.2% where in the past year serving 112 flights.

He revealed the number of seats to provide in the current year is about 30 thousand seats. Moreover, according to Edward, the level of on time performance (OTP) also showed a positive trend which reached 82%. "The OTP of Lion Air has exceeded the recommended average of 80%," said Edward Sirait.

According to Edward, during the Islamic holiday, Lion Air routes increased significantly are Surabaya-Balikpapan, Surabaya-Banjarmasin, Jakarta-Jogjakarta, Jakarta-Solo and Jakarta-Padang. The increase in the routes, he added, reaching 15% compared to a normal day.

Edward said they had added 200 seats per day during to serve the increasing demand for flights on the busy routes . "Lion Air also increase the frequency of four flights for four days with a total of 4800 additional seats to serve the reverse flow. We have budgeted an additional flight on demand," he said.

LION AIR as the WORST airline in the On Time Performance
lion_air_on_time_performance_the_worst_airline_indonesia

Lion Air was recorded as the worst airline in the timeliness - the on time performance (OTP) in Indonesia. Based on the results recap of the Ministry of Transportation during the I quarter of 2011, the Lion Air’s OTP average only reaches 66.45%.

According Ministry of Transportation, this is not the first time of the airline that owned by PT Lion Mentari Airlines has record a poor performance in the OTP. During January - April 2011, the Lion Air on time perfomance had reached a low of 54.30% in February. Whereas the highest achieved in April OTP at 77.30%.

Batavia Airlines OTP rate slightly better, reaching 68.83%. While the best OTP is still held by Garuda Indonesia 86.98%, while the OTP of Merpati Airlines 75.60%, Sriwijaya Air 74% and AirAsia 71.96%.

Director General of Civil Aviation, Herry Bakti, ask the airline who has punctuality rate into a bad category to improve its performance so that it can reach 80%. "They have to arrange the schedule according to ability," he said.

Herry said, airlines are often late is usually caused by high frequency of flights, but not matched with the fleet and adequate human resources. As for Lion Air, Ministry of Transportation has given sanction in the form of six-unit reduction in the frequency of plane flights.

Flight Observer, Ruth Hannah Simatupang, argues, to improve the on time performance, the airline should work with other airlines during a delay or cancellation. "So far, the only Garuda Indonesia has did it and it was for international routes," said Ruth..

Edward Sirait, General Director of Lion Air, pledging it will continue to improve the on time performance. Since reducing the frequency of flights, the OTP has increased. "Our last July OTP 76%," said Edward. In addition to reducing the frequency, Lion Air also increase the OTP by adding ground time from 35 minutes to 45 minutes.
